Output 26e351e8c61ef32abaa1a13df73527bd92b09fe9331a9a8e2bd00199c7448990:2

value
130193060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f337d096d49e78debafabccd69fb63a3fb3acf0 OP_EQUAL
address
3ANPoFEFrWvmWU3xck5pjAbbBbs8GhBo2V
transaction
26e351e8c61ef32abaa1a13df73527bd92b09fe9331a9a8e2bd00199c7448990
spent
true